Falcons just beat the #1 team in the world. NiKo and m0NESY dismantled Vitality 2-1 in the Group A Upper Bracket Final at IEM Rio 2026, and kyxsan, the IGL everyone was writing obituaries for 48 hours ago, delivered when it mattered most. Falcons advance straight to the semi-finals. Vitality drop to the quarters.
Final scoreline:
- Mirage โ 13:10 Falcons
- Dust2 โ 13:6 Vitality
- Nuke โ 16:14 Falcons
This is the biggest Falcons win of 2026. And the timing could not be louder.
How Falcons Beat Vitality at IEM Rio
Falcons opened on Mirage, their own pick, their comfort map, their playground. m0NESY ran the mid, NiKo cleaned up B, and Vitality never found an answer. 13-10, series lead, no panic.
Then Vitality did what Vitality do. Their Dust2 is a cheat code, a map they hadn’t lost on in months, and ZywOo flipped the switch. 13-6, brutal, clinical. Series tied. Everyone in the Farmasi Arena braced for the French steamroller to finish the job on Nuke.
It never came.
Nuke went 16-14, and it went to overtime because Falcons refused to die. kyxsan, the player the entire scene had mentally benched for karrigan 24 hours earlier, was composed in the biggest rounds of his year. m0NESY was the engine with consistent impact across all three maps. NiKo was the firepower. TeSeS and NucleonZ (in for kyousuke) held the structure. Five guys, zero wobble.
VRS shift:
- Falcons +47 pt โ 1866 pt (up to world #5)
- Vitality -24 pt โ 2069 pt (still #1, gap closing)
Vitality Lose UB Final in Rio: First Real Crack in the Armor
Vitality were 44-6 in map record over the last three months before this series. They entered Rio at world #1, with an ESL bounty of $100,000 on the table for the team that beats them in the Grand Final. That bounty is still live, assuming Vitality navigate the lower bracket to get there. But the aura just took a serious hit.
ZywOo had his moments on Dust2. apEX’s IGL calls on Nuke late-round got exposed, specifically in the overtime rifle rounds, where Falcons’ utility usage was simply cleaner. ropz and flameZ couldn’t bail the team out in the clutch. mezii was quiet across two of three maps.
Vitality now fall to the quarter-finals and need to win an extra series just to get back to the semi. The path to the title just got longer, and the VRS hit stings.
Kyxsan Answers the Karrigan Reports the Loudest Way Possible
Context matters here. Multiple outlets have reported Falcons are in advanced talks with karrigan to replace kyxsan as IGL after Rio, with sources suggesting the move is close to official. zonic has publicly dodged the question. NiKo has publicly dodged the question. kyxsan, asked directly by HLTV earlier this week, said: “My job is to come here and play, and that’s what I’m doing.”
He just did.
A huge series win on the biggest stage of his career, against the #1 team in the world, in the middle of a transfer storm aimed directly at his seat. The late-round call on the Nuke decider economy was his. Whatever happens in the transfer window, that tape exists now. Falcons are reportedly still moving on karrigan regardless, but the conversation inside the org just got a lot more awkward.
What’s Next: Falcons Semi-Final at IEM Rio 2026
Falcons jump to 5th in the world rankings. Their semi-final opponent will come out of the Group B bracket, either FURIA (live on home soil with the Brazilian crowd behind them) or MOUZ.
Vitality, meanwhile, face a quarter-final grinder. Spirit, NAVI, G2, FURIA, MOUZ โ pick your poison. The $125,000 first prize is still on the table. So is the $100K bounty, if they can claw their way back to Sunday.
